However, when the voice starts giving more and more specific suggestions, Misery begins to listen and is catapulted from marauder to messiah. In fact Misery has already begun hearing voices. Misery has the power to manipulate certain types of stones, but is all too aware that this means they will likely die of voidmadness like their mother did. “The Genesis of Misery” by Neon Yang is a science fiction novel about Misery, a petty criminal from a backwater planet, who has found themselves in hot water again.
